Core Insights - The article discusses the changes to income-driven repayment (IDR) plans and loan forgiveness for federal student loan borrowers due to President Trump's One Big Beautiful Bill (OBBB) [1][16] IDR Plans Overview - Approximately 29% of federal loan borrowers are enrolled in IDR plans, which base monthly payments on a percentage of discretionary income and offer repayment terms of 20 or 25 years [2] - Current IDR plans include Income-Based Repayment (IBR), Income-Contingent Repayment (ICR), and Pay As You Earn (PAYE) [5][10] Payment Examples - A borrower with $20,000 in Grad PLUS Loans at an 8.9% interest rate would pay $226 monthly under a standard plan, but only $96 under PAYE, with forgiveness after 20 years [3] Future Changes to IDR Plans - Significant changes to IDR plans will take effect in July 2026, transitioning to a single Repayment Assistance Plan (RAP) for new borrowers, requiring 30 years of payments for forgiveness [5][16] - Current borrowers must transition to IBR, RAP, or standard repayment by July 1, 2028, as ICR and PAYE will be phased out [18] Parent PLUS Loan Borrowers - New Parent PLUS Loan borrowers after July 1, 2026, will not be eligible for ICR or loan forgiveness through IDR plans [19] - Current Parent PLUS borrowers must consolidate loans and enroll in ICR before the deadline to maintain eligibility for forgiveness [20]
